Summary

NXF2 (nuclear RNA export factor 2, HGNC:8072) is a protein-coding gene on chromosome Xq22.1, encoding Nuclear RNA export factor 2 (Q9GZY0). Involved in the export of mRNA from the nucleus to the cytoplasm.

This gene encodes a member of a family of nuclear RNA export proteins. The encoded protein is associated with the nuclear envelope and aids in the export of mRNAs. There is a closely related paralog of this gene located adjacent on chromosome X and on the opposite strand.

Source: NCBI Gene 56001 — RefSeq curated summary.

UniProt curated annotations — full annotation on UniProt →

Function. Involved in the export of mRNA from the nucleus to the cytoplasm.

Subunit / interactions. Interacts with NXT1, NXT2, E1B-AP5, the REF proteins and with nucleoporins, Nup62, Nup153 and Nup214. Interacts with LUZP4.

Subcellular location. Nucleus. Nucleoplasm. Cytoplasm.

Tissue specificity. Expressed almost exclusively in testis. Also expressed in several cancers.

Domain organisation. The NTF2 domain heterodimerizes with NXT1 and NXT2. The formation of NXF1/NXT1 heterodimers is required for NXF2-mediated nuclear mRNA export. The leucine-rich repeats and the NTF2-domain are essential for the export of mRNA from the nucleus. The C-terminal fragment, containing the TAP domain (also called UBA-like domain) and part of the NTF2-like domain, named the NPC-binding domain, mediates direct interactions with nucleoporin-FG-repeats and is necessary and sufficient for localization of NXF2 to the nuclear rim. The RNA-binding domain is a non-canonical RNP-type domain.

Similarity. Belongs to the NXF family.
